![]() |
ЗУП без спроса округляет удержания. При расчете удержаний процентом от базы программа сама округляет результат как хочет. Пример (комментарий расчета): Расчет *Профвзносы Способ расчета: Произвольная формула Порядок расчета: Окр(Расчетная база*Профвзнос,2) Базовые начисления составили всего: 7 089,8 Профвзнос: 0,01 Расчетная база: 7 089,8 Результат расчета: 70,9 Расчет *Благосостояние/личный взнос/ Способ расчета: Произвольная формула Порядок расчета: Окр(Процент * Расчетная база ,2) Базовые начисления составили всего: 7 089,8 Процент: 0,046 Расчетная база: 7 089,8 Результат расчета: 326 т.е. Профвзносы округлены до десятка копеек, а Благосостояние до целых рублей. Хотя в формулах вида расчета в обоих случаях указано Окр(,2). Как исправить ситуацию? |
ну профвзносы понятно 70.898 = 70.90 |
Пойти в школу. 7089.8*0.01=70.898. округление до 2-х знаков будет 70.90 Второй пример сам разбирай. |
(2) да, профвзносы понятно. а вот 4,6% удержание должно быть 326,13. Причем в доплатах те же 4,6% рассчитываются верно, с точностью до копеек. |
попробуй 3 или 4 напиши, что будет |
5-angro > Полагаю, он какие-то промежуточные вычисления не выложил. "Сократил", как "ненужные" ;) |
(5) не-не-не. все выложено. Вот если то же самое удержание ввести как разовое - считает правильно. А если как плановое - то обрезает копейки. Начисления процентом считаются одинаково и как разовые и как плановые. |
Текущее время: 15:46. Часовой пояс GMT +3. |